Over 220 children attended the Star Pals 2012 Annual Fishing Derby. Each child was required to go through registration and 5 learning stations before fishing. Members of the Department of Fish and Game as well as members of the San Diego Fly Fishers Association were running the stations. Each child was given a t-shirt and then bait for fishing. Volunteers were used as lake walkers, fishing pier buddies, repair stations, fishing pole distribution and to prepare for the barbecue luncheon for all children, their parent and for volunteers. There was an awards ceremony after lunch to provide prizes for the the largest and smallest fish caught and the most fish caught. May 18th, 2012 Wishing You The Best On Your Special Day ![]()

Alana Ethridge Shines Both on Stage and OffHow One Young Actress Gives BackBy Susan LeakWhen one of my musician friends, Scott Isbell, came to me and told me about his friend , Alana Ethridge, I had no idea how inspiring this young lady was. In today's tough, competitive world, it is refreshing to find there are still some that do things to help others, just because it is the right thing to do and because they can. Alana is one of those people. A show biz veteran at the age of 14, Alana has a resume that includes Print ads and TV Commercials, TV, (Most notably in 2006/2007 season of Are you Smarter Than a 5th Grader )., theater, music videos, and Films including "A Simple Promise" and "Until The Music Stops". She is also the National Spokesperson for "Story Time For Me". But what makes her stand out is her Mentorship program. Alana's Achievers is a program Alana started to help kid pursue their dreams. As an actress, Alana knows it not only takes hard work to fulfill your dreams, but it funding as well. "I feel that it's important to start a mentor program to help other kids achieve their dreams and set positive goals in life. I want to help as many kids as I can, especially, the ones from families who do not have transportation or have the money to participate in after school activities whether it's sports, music classes, dance classes, acting, being a Boy or Girl Scout, or go to the neighborhood park." she explains. Alana's Achievers focus is on encouraging good habits for kids, from maintaining good grades to eating healthy and exercising. In order for Alana to raise funds, she and fellow cast-mate from Are You As Smart As a 5th Grader, Jacob Hays teamed up with Mediak Corp to produce a personalized DVD for the younger kids, "You Can Do Anything" Not only is your child's name on cover, but the name is also added into the lyrics of the songs. Up beat and encouraging, this DVD has inspired many kids all ready and has funded several grants from the Alana's Achievers. Now, one would think that is enough, but not Alana. She is also active with Kourtney's Krew - helping to raise money to assist young Kourney Najjar and others with the huge mountain medical expenses from multiple organ transplants. How would one describe this amazing young lady? Alana's Achievers Twitter stream says it best "The value of a man resides in what he gives and not in what he is capable of receiving. ~ Albert Einstein" . That is the way Alana lives. Her heart and spirit make her a very bright star both on stage and off. February 2nd, 2011

For those of you who don't know what the Pepsi Refresh Project is, it's a project in which Pepsi gives $1.3 Million each month, to support other change-making projects. Each month 32 finalists are given various amounts based upon them receiving the highest number of votes for that month.

Playathon Fundraiser This past Saturday, Alana's Achievers hosted a Hasbro Games Playathon which raised $430 for the Kourtney Najjar Transplant Fund. Thanks to all who helped out!
Kourtney is 7 years old and awaiting a multi-organ transplant. The cost of an intestinal/pancreas transplant can exceed $1,000,000 and that is only the beginning. Even with health coverage, Kourtney's family faces significant medical expenses related to her transplant. For the rest of her life, she will need follow-up care and daily anti-rejection medications. The cost of post transplant medication can range from $2,000 to $5,000 per month -- and they are as critical to her survival as the transplant itself.
